How to make pineapple nastar rolls..

Published on Feb 6, 2016 These are Pineapple Nastar Rolls, and you'll need a Nastar cookie mould for this recipe. Learn how to make them with my video tutorial, and Happy Baking. Pineapple Jam 2 Large Ripe Pineapples, skin and cut into chunks 200 g to 300 g Sugar (adjust accordingly) 2 cloves 5 cm Cinnamon Stick 3 Pandan leaves, cleaned and knotted 60 g Golden Syrup or Maltose Video Guide: https://youtu.be/FmJ2I__5ZVo Pastry 250 g Unsalted Butter, softened 50 g Confectioner Sugar 1/2 tsp of Sea Salt 1 tsp Vanilla Extract 2 Large Egg Yolks 350 g All-Purpose Flour, sifted 50 g Corn Flour/Starch, sifted 2 Large Egg Yolks, lightly beaten for egg wash For Full Recipe: http://www.seasaltwithfood.com/2013/0...
